4. What is sent to our server, and when

Both categories land in the same Supabase project — a hosted PostgreSQL service.

4.1. Usage events — sent without an account

Once you have accepted this policy in the app, Witto sends usage events to the analytics_events table. No account is needed for this. Events are queued on the device and uploaded in batches; the upload is gated on your acceptance, not on having an account.

Every event carries:

FieldWhat it is
Event identifiera random identifier the app assigns to each event so that the same event is not recorded twice if a batch is sent again
Installation identifiera random identifier created on first launch and kept in the app's settings. It is not your app store identifier, not your device identifier and not an advertising identifier — but it does persist across launches and lets events from this installation be grouped together.
Account identifierpresent only if you are signed in, absent otherwise
Session identifieridentifies one run of the app
Event namewhat happened: app opened, lesson started, subscription screen shown, purchase completed
Parametersa small set of structured values: which screen, which exercise variant, which plan, how many games were done. Free text is not permitted here.
Time of the eventwhen it happened
App version and buildwhich version it happened in
Platform and languagethe operating system, and the interface language

What is deliberately kept out: your name, your email address, your age, your screen-time answer and your self-ratings. For the onboarding questions the app records that a question was answered, never the answer itself. A filter in the app enforces this — it accepts only a fixed list of parameter keys, rejects keys such as name, email, age and answer outright, and rejects values that look like free text or contain an "@".

The app can only insert rows into this table. It cannot read, update or delete them. Events are deleted automatically 180 days after they occurred.

4.2. Your progress — only if you sign in

If you sign in, the app keeps a copy of your progress so a replacement device can pick it up. Six tables are synced, each row tied to your account:

TableWhat it holds
Profiledisplay name, subscription status and its expiry
Progressexperience, level, streak, modules, awards
Training statedifficulty, accuracy, play counts, personal bests, library choices
Scoresbrain-age value, when it was computed, per-skill breakdown
Test snapshotstest date, brain-age range, per-skill values
Daily totalsexperience, sessions, accuracy totals and minutes per day

Your individual exercise results never leave the device. The per-round records are deliberately excluded from sync and have no table on the server.

Every row is tied to your account identifier, and the database enforces row-level security: a request can only read or write rows whose owner matches the signed-in user. Without a session, no rows are returned at all.

5. Where the data physically sits

Our Supabase project runs in the eu-north-1 region (Stockholm, Sweden) on Amazon Web Services infrastructure. This is inside the European Economic Area, so no transfer outside the EEA takes place over this channel.

Supabase acts as our data processor under its data processing agreement.

8. Signing in

Signing in is optional; the app is fully usable without an account. When you sign in with Apple, Witto asks for exactly two things: your name and your email address. Nothing else. If you choose Apple's private relay address, that relay address is what we receive, not your real one. The app also periodically checks whether the sign-in is still valid, so it can tell you if access was revoked.

13. Payments

Subscriptions are sold and billed by the app store you installed Witto from — the Apple App Store or Google Play. Witto never sees or handles your card details, and they never reach our servers. The app stores only a flag saying whether a subscription is active and when it expires.

14. Age

Witto is intended for people aged 16 and over. We deliberately do not collect data from children below that age. If you believe a child under 16 is using the app with an account, write to support@witto.tech and we will delete that account and the data associated with it.

The age-range question in onboarding includes an "under 18" option — it is used only to interpret the result, and it neither grants nor restricts access to anything.

16. This website

witto.tech is a set of static pages. It sets no cookies, embeds no fonts, scripts or images from other domains, and runs no analytics. Requests are handled by our hosting provider Beget, which keeps standard server logs including IP addresses. The provider does not publicly disclose how long those logs are retained.
